FMC Corporation Acquires Benalaxyl Fungicide from Isagro
29 Jun 2009 -
FMC Corporation announced the purchase of the proprietary fungicide Benalaxyl from Isagro S.p.A. The acquisition includes all Benalaxyl registrations, intellectual properties and trademarks, including GALBEN®, TAIREL® and TRECATOL®.
Benalaxyl is a systemic fungicide for control of oomycetes, or water molds, in grapes, potatoes and several vegetable crops. Benalaxyl has been included in Europe in Annex I in 2004 and is registered in more than 50 countries worldwide. "Benalaxyl will provide FMC with a proprietary building block for the development of superior fungicide products,” said Marc Hullebroeck, International Business Director Eurasia, Africa & Middle East, FMC Agricultural Products.
